I've been comparing brokers and I'm wondering about something. Most often when brokers state that they offer Standard, Mini and Micro lot sizes, this means that it is possible to open a trade with respectively volume of 1, 0.1 and 0.01, representing respectively 100000, 10000 and 1000 units of the base currency.
However, some brokers (i know of one, trading point) have a micro account where one lot represents 1000 units. This means that entering a trade of 0.01 lots represents only 10 units of the base currency. Are there other brokers out there where this is possible?
